Warehouses are busy environments where employees, machinery, inventory, and vehicles operate together every day. With constant movement, dust accumulation, packaging waste, spills, and heavy equipment activity, maintaining a clean warehouse can be challenging.
However, warehouse cleaning is not simply about keeping the facility tidy. A structured cleaning program helps improve workplace safety, supports operational efficiency, protects inventory, and contributes to compliance requirements. Warehouse cleaning plays an important role in protecting inventory.
Dust, moisture, and debris can affect stored products.
Regular cleaning helps:
Businesses storing food products, electronics, or medical supplies often place additional emphasis on cleanliness.
